Chapter 59 Emerald Home, Original Manuscript
Aiden continued, "The Natural School has been declining in recent years. In terms of combat strength, it is no match for the Arcane School and the Bloodline School. But one school has high requirements for basic mental strength, and the other will make you neither human nor ghost. I can't accept that."
"Let's tentatively settle on Emerald Home for now. Emerald Home specializes in wood and water-based meditation and witchcraft," Aiden decided, tilting his head back.
"After all, I know absolutely nothing about choosing from thousands of wizarding organizations," Aiden said, scratching his head with a helpless expression.
But Aiden knew.
He needs a stable environment, one that doesn't involve daily fighting or where the organization's members are constantly scheming and backstabbing.
He needs time to develop.
Moreover, his wizarding talent was not particularly good. His initial mental strength was extremely low.
Although he now has the special talent of having a basic mana pocket to make up for it, he is still far from being a true genius!
For example, Galatea has high initial mental strength and two special talents.
Soon, all three had chosen their respective wizarding organizations. Bondi selected a wizarding organization under the Central Arcane School, but he hadn't decided which one yet.
Galatea chose a wizarding organization under the School of Souls.
Aiden's primary target was the Emerald Home, where Ms. Ollie lived.
Bondi, somewhat puzzled, frowned and opened his mouth, asking, "Aiden, is there anything special about this Emerald Home? How did you identify the wizarding organization so quickly?"
"Because Ms. Ollie is there, and she specifically asked me to take her. I'll get better treatment if I go in." Aiden smiled and showed her the acceptance letter Ms. Ollie had given him earlier.
"Wow!" Galatea and Bondi gasped, their eyes wide and mouths agape.
"You got accepted in the early admission round," Bondi said, patting Aiden on the shoulder with an envious look on his face.
Galatea nodded silently.
Through this period of time and her additional understanding of Aiden, she knew that this mysterious man had been working hard behind the scenes all along.
Soon, the three of them had a meal together. After they had eaten and drunk their fill, they parted ways, their figures gradually disappearing into the night.
……
Two weeks later, one night, a strong wind howled outside the window, making the window rattle loudly.
Aiden sat with his eyes closed, resting, while waiting for Fluttershy to return from poisoning Mr. Ironbeard's laboratory.
Soon, Little Butterfly fluttered her wings and flew back, still carrying a chill with her.
Xiaodie said, "Dad, there's a very special little door here."
Aiden looked puzzled, placed his hands on the table, and asked, "Small door? What's a small door?"
"It's a small door, a small door hidden in a corner," Little Butterfly said weakly, her wings trembling.
"Then open this door." Aiden was silent for a moment, his brows furrowed, before he spoke.
"Little Butterfly's intelligence is really like a child's," Aiden thought to himself with a smile, a smile playing on his lips.
"Dad, I need time to crack it," Xiaodie said weakly.
"Then be careful."
He watched as Xiaodie entered the light array, which shimmered with a strange light, enveloping Xiaodie's figure within it.
It wasn't until two hours later that Xiaodie returned.
Its wings were flapping very slowly, and it looked extremely tired.
Then, Xiaodie pulled a parchment scroll out of her spatial pocket out of thin air. The movement was a little difficult, and the parchment scroll swayed in the air before landing on the table.
"Great!"
Aiden quickly stood up, walked briskly to Little Butterfly's side, gently stroked Little Butterfly's head to comfort her, and then eagerly opened the parchment scroll.
As he read, a look of surprise gradually appeared on his face, and his mouth opened wider and wider.
Finally, unable to control his expression, he grinned and burst into laughter, the sound echoing throughout the room.
"Holy crap, this thing is the initial manuscript, which is a small part of Mr. Ironbeard's experimental results!" Aiden excitedly waved his arms and shouted.
The manuscript clearly describes the methods and proportions for extracting biological materials, such as the number of distillations and the components of the experimental reagents added.
The final result is an enhanced version of the biological lure, which can greatly increase the creatures' favorability and lower their guard.
Aiden didn't know the extent of the biological trap's effect, but it was certainly effective at least at the biological level of wizards below the first ring.
Even his little butterfly really likes the smell of this biological attractant.
"Little Butterfly, Little Butterfly, do you have any other manuscripts?" Aiden leaned forward, his face showing urgency as he asked impatiently.
"There are still many more." Xiaodie's voice was so weak it was like a mosquito's buzz. As she spoke, her small body trembled, and she took out many manuscripts from her spatial pocket. The manuscripts fell onto the table like snowflakes, piling up into a small mountain.
Aiden quickly glanced through the manuscript, his fingers rustling as he flipped through the pages. "All these manuscripts together make up a complete biological trap. However, there are some new manuscripts, which seem to be optimizing the original, and there are also various points that raise questions."
Aiden thought about it carefully, his brows furrowing before relaxing, and he said seriously, "It seems that the biological trap is complete, but Mr. Ironbeard is not satisfied and is still conducting experiments, probably hoping to make a name for himself."
Aiden smiled and said, "It's just a pity that your achievements are now mine!"
He then stroked his chin and continued, "Xiaodie, put these things back exactly as they were, don't alert them. It would be terrible if they found out."
Aiden paused, licked his lips, and said, "I have to take it the day before the wizard ship arrives, then he won't be able to do anything to me. Mr. Ironbeard will be furious if he loses the initial manuscript."
"Okay, Daddy," Little Butterfly replied weakly, slowing down the frequency of its wing flapping as it regained its strength.
Then it darted back into the small light array. The light array flickered a few times, and Little Butterfly's figure disappeared. It put all the stolen parchment scrolls back and then returned.
"You've really worked hard, Little Butterfly." Aiden said with a gentle smile, reaching out to touch its antennae.
"He won't notice if you put it back, will he?" Aiden sat up straight, his expression serious, and instructed.
"No. Once I've opened that little door, I can keep it open forever," Xiaodie said weakly, her head bowed and antennae drooping.
Aiden smiled and said, "That's good, that's good."
His laughter echoed through the room.
These days, Mr. Tesh has hired another assistant.
This assistant wasn't as arrogant as before; each time, she would just hurry over to borrow biological materials from Ms. Ollie's lab.
Aiden was very cooperative.
Perhaps Mr. Ironbeard was already overwhelmed by Aiden's poisoning and was completely dejected.
